The Director, Extension Services in the Federal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Development, Aderemi Abioye, has said that  less than 3 per cent of women in Nigeria have access to agricultural credit facilities.

Speaking at the two-day workshop on validation of Draft Agricultural Gender Policy  in Abuja on Thursday, Abioye lamented that less than 5 per cent of women have access to land; only 4 per cent have access to agricultural extension services while less than 22 per cent have access to farm inputs.
